Abstract

The utility model discloses a pleat removing device for working clothes cloth processing, which relates to the field of pleat removing devices and comprises a machine base, wherein a steam nozzle is arranged above the machine base, a right cross beam is arranged on the right side of the steam nozzle, a left cross beam is arranged on the left side of the steam nozzle, a first motor seat is arranged on the rear side of the left cross beam, a first motor is arranged above the first motor seat, a first motor fixing clamp is arranged above the first motor, the first motor fixing clamp is fixed with the first motor seat, the first motor is connected with a cloth scroll, a left clamping table is arranged on the left side of the cloth scroll, a right clamping table is arranged on the right side of the cloth scroll, a plurality of flattening rollers are arranged on the cloth pleat removing device, the steam nozzle and a flattening plate are further arranged, and the pleat removing effect of the cloth can be better flattened.

Description

Pleat removing device for working clothes cloth processing
Technical Field
The utility model relates to the field of pleat removing devices, in particular to a pleat removing device for working clothes and cloth processing.
Background
The cloth removes the pleat device and is one of the most commonly used equipment of textile industry, can naturally have some folds after the cloth is produced, just need to use the equipment of removing the fold to remove the pleat operation to the cloth at this moment for the cloth is more level and smooth, and later stage processing is more convenient.
However, the existing equipment for removing wrinkles needs manual operation, most of the cloth for processing the working clothes is cotton-flax cloth, wrinkles are generated more easily, the cloth needs to be subjected to the wrinkle removing operation by steam heating and warming, the wrinkles of the equipment for manual operation are not uniform, and operators are tidily and easily scalded.

Detailed Description
The present utility model will be described in further detail with reference to the following examples in order to make the objects, technical solutions and advantages of the present utility model more apparent. It should be understood that the specific embodiments described herein are for purposes of illustration only and are not intended to limit the scope of the utility model.
Referring to fig. 1-3, this embodiment provides a pleat removing device for working clothes cloth processing, including machine base 1, machine base 1 top is provided with vapor nozzle 20, vapor nozzle 20 right side is provided with right crossbeam 3, vapor nozzle 20 left side is provided with left crossbeam 2, left crossbeam 2 rear side is provided with first motor cabinet 4, first motor cabinet 4 top is provided with first motor 5, first motor 5 top is provided with first motor fixing clip 6, first motor fixing clip 6 is fixed with first motor cabinet 4, first motor 5 is connected with cloth spool 9, cloth spool 9 left side is provided with left clamping table 7, cloth spool 9 right side is provided with right clamping table 8.
Further, a first flattening roller 11 is arranged in front of the cloth scroll 9, a second flattening roller 10 is arranged below the first flattening roller 11, the diameter of the second flattening roller 10 is larger than that of the first flattening roller 11, a first driven wheel 12 is arranged on the left side of the second flattening roller 10, the first driven wheel 12 is connected with a driving belt 13, the driving belt 13 drives the first driven wheel 12 to rotate, and the first driven wheel 12 drives the second flattening roller 10 to rotate.
Further, the front of the first flattening roller 11 is provided with a movable flattening plate 15, the movable flattening plate 15 is connected with a connecting rod 18, the connecting rod 18 is connected with a fixing head 19, the connecting rod 18 is arranged in a movable groove 17, the movable flattening plate 15 can move up and down along the movable groove 17, the fixing head 19 can fix the movable flattening plate 15, a fixed flattening plate 16 is arranged below the movable flattening plate 15, and the movable flattening plate 15 and the fixed flattening plate 16 are mutually extruded to preliminarily flatten cloth.
Further, a third flattening roller 22 is arranged in front of the steam nozzle 20, a fourth flattening roller 23 is arranged below the third flattening roller 22, a second driven wheel 21 is arranged on the left side of the fourth flattening roller 23, the second driven wheel 21 is connected with the driving belt 13, and cloth heated and humidified through the steam nozzle 20 is flattened further through the third flattening roller 22 and the fourth flattening roller 23.
Further, a first conveying roller 27 is arranged in front of the third flattening roller 22, a second conveying roller 28 is arranged below the first conveying roller 27, a second motor 25 is linked to the left side of the second conveying roller 28, a second motor seat 24 is arranged below the second motor 25, the second motor seat 24 is connected with the left cross beam 2, the second motor 25 is connected with a second motor card 26, and the second motor card 26 is fixed with the second motor seat 24.
Further, a protective shell 30 is arranged above the machine base 1, a spreading groove 29 is formed in the protective shell 30, a transmission motor 31 is arranged below the machine base 1, a transmission motor seat 32 is arranged below the transmission motor 31, a driving wheel 14 is connected to the left side of the transmission motor 31, and the driving wheel 14 is connected with a transmission belt 13.
The working principle of the utility model is as follows: when the pleat removing device works, the transmission motor 31 is started, the transmission motor 31 drives the transmission belt 13 to rotate, the transmission belt 13 drives the first driven wheel 12 and the second driven wheel 21 to rotate, thereby driving the second flattening roller 10 and the fourth flattening roller 23 to rotate, the first motor 5 is started, the first motor 5 drives the cloth scroll 9 to rotate, the second motor 25 drives the second conveying roller 28 to rotate, raw cloth passes through between the first conveying roller 27 and the second conveying roller 28 to be conveyed, then passes through between the third flattening roller 22 and the fourth flattening roller 23 to be primarily pleated, then passes through the cloth conveying groove 29 to enter the protective shell 30, steam is sprayed upwards by the steam spray head 20, the heated and humidified raw cloth passes through the space between the movable flattening plate 15 and the fixed flattening plate 16, the movable flattening plate 15 compresses the raw cloth downwards, then passes through the space between the first flattening roller 11 and the second flattening roller 10 to be flattened further, and then passes through the cloth scroll 9 to be rolled into a cloth scroll.
